Medallion Bank (Nasdaq: MBNKP, “the Bank”), an FDIC-insured bank providing consumer loans for the purchase of recreational vehicles, boats and home improvements, along with loan origination services to fintech partners, announced today its 2020 first quarter results. The Bank is a wholly owned subsidiary of Medallion Financial Corp. (Nasdaq: MFIN).
2020 First Quarter Highlights
Donald Poulton, President and Chief Executive Officer of Medallion Bank, stated, “The Bank had a strong start to the year but the escalating COVID-19 pandemic led us to increase our loan loss reserves in March. In addition, transaction activity during the quarter indicated the need to lower medallion collateral values substantially in New York City, which reduced the Bank’s net income by approximately $7 million. While it is too early to predict how our consumer portfolio will be affected by the current economic disruption, we structured the Bank with resilience in mind and remain optimistic the Bank is well positioned to respond to opportunities to grow market share. The annualized consumer loan delinquency rate is only modestly higher than it was this time last year, our capital position remains strong, and our focus is on credit quality while moving forward cautiously. I am proud of how our employees have adapted and continued serving our customers and borrowers while working remotely. They demonstrate every day why we are a leader in our chosen niches.”
Recreation Lending Segment
The Bank’s gross recreation loan portfolio was $720.2 million as of March 31, 2020, compared to $699.5 million at the end of 2019. Net interest income for the first quarter was $22.8 million, compared to $19.6 million in the prior year period. Recreation loans were 66.2% of the Bank’s loans receivable as of March 31, 2020, compared to 65.9% at the end of 2019.
Home Improvement Lending Segment
The Bank’s gross home improvement loan portfolio was $260.6 million as of March 31, 2020, compared to $252.1 at the end of 2019. Net interest income for the first quarter was $4.6 million, compared to $3.5 million in the prior year period. Home improvement loans were 24.0% of the Bank’s loans receivable as of March 31, 2020, compared to 23.7% at the end of 2019.
Medallion Lending Segment
The Banks’s gross medallion loan portfolio was $105.1 million as of March 31, 2020, compared to $108.4 million at the end of 2019. Medallion loan delinquencies 90 days or more past due were $1.2 million as of March 31, 2020, compared to $0.4 million at the end of 2019. Medallion loan delinquencies 30 days or more past due were $22.4 million as of March 31, 2020, compared to $10.3 million at the end of 2019 Medallion loans were 9.7% of the Bank’s loans receivable as of March 31, 2020, compared to 10.2% at the end of 2019.
On April 29, 2020, the Bank’s Board of Directors declared a quarterly cash dividend of $0.50 per share on the Bank’s Fixed-to-Floating Rate Non-Cumulative Perpetual Preferred Stock, Series F, which trades on the Nasdaq Capital Market under the ticker symbol “MBNKP.” The dividend is payable on July 1, 2020 to holders of record at the close of business on June 15, 2020.
About Medallion Bank
Medallion Bank specializes in providing consumer loans for the purchase of recreational vehicles, boats and home improvements, and offering loan origination services to fintech partners. The Bank works directly with thousands of dealers, contractors and financial service providers serving their customers throughout the United States. Since its founding in 2003, Medallion Bank has been in the top 2% of banks in the U.S. when measured by Tier 1 leverage ratio and annual return on assets. The Bank is a Utah-chartered, FDIC-insured industrial bank headquartered in Salt Lake City with an office in Bothell, Washington.
